G1268

διανέμω

dianemo

dee-an-em'-o

Verb

from G1223 and the base of G3551; to distribute, i.e. (of information) to disseminate:--spread.

  1. to distribute, divide

G4766

στρώννυμι

stronnumi

stro'-o

Verb

(probably akin to G4731 through the idea of positing); to "strew," i.e. spread (as a carpet or couch):--make bed, furnish, spread, strew.

  1. to spread
  2. furnish
  3. to spread with couches or divans

H5186

נָטָה

natah

naw-taw'

Verb

a primitive root; to stretch or spread out; by implication, to bend away (including moral deflection); used in a great variety of application (as follows):--+ afternoon, apply, bow (down, - ing), carry aside, decline, deliver, extend, go down, be gone, incline, intend, lay, let down, offer, outstretched, overthrown, pervert, pitch, prolong, put away, shew, spread (out), stretch (forth, out), take (aside), turn (aside, away), wrest, cause to yield.

  1. to stretch out, extend, spread out, pitch, turn, pervert, incline, bend, bow
    1. (Qal)
      1. to stretch out, extend, stretch, offer
      2. to spread out, pitch (tent)
      3. to bend, turn, incline 1a
    2. to turn aside, incline, decline, bend down 1a
    3. to bend, bow 1a
    4. to hold out, extend (fig.)
    5. (Niphal) to be stretched out
    6. (Hiphil)
      1. to stretch out
      2. to spread out
      3. to turn, incline, influence, bend down, hold out, extend, thrust aside, thrust away

H6566

פָּרַשׂ

paras

paw-ras'

Verb

a primitive root; to break apart, disperse, etc.:--break, chop in pieces, lay open, scatter, spread (abroad, forth, selves, out), stretch (forth, out).

  1. to spread, spread out, stretch, break in pieces
    1. (Qal)
      1. to spread out, display
      2. to spread over
    2. (Niphal) to be scattered, be spread out
    3. (Piel)
      1. to spread out
      2. to scatter
